TWAS Fellows: the apex of scientific achievement

TWAS is a pioneering, merit-based academy focused on scientific excellence in the developing world. Only scientists who have made significant contributions to the advancement of science in the developing world can be nominated as TWAS Fellows. Those elected hold permanent membership.

Young Affiliates Alumni

When Young Affiliates complete their five-year term, they become Alumni. Young Affiliate Alumni are encouraged to remain engaged with TWAS initiatives and to take advantage of TWAS programmes and prizes.
